SystImmune is a leading and well-funded cl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company located in Redmond, WA and Princeton, NJ. It specializes in developing innovative cancer treatments using its established drug development platforms, focusing on bi-specific, multi-specific antibodies, and ant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s). SystImmune has multiple assets in various stages of clinical trials for solid tumor and hematologic indications. Alongside ongoing clinical trials. SystImmune has a robust preclinical pipeline of potential cancer therapeutics in the discover and IND-enabling stages, representing cutting-edge biologics development. We are seeking a Research Associate or Senior Research Associate to join our Protein Engineering team. This role is ideal for a highly motivated individual with strong molecular biology skills and a passion for scientific innovation. This position offers an exciting opportunity to work in a dynamic and innovative environment focused on the development of novel therapeutic antibodies.
Responsibilities
- Perform routine and complex molecular biology techniques including PCR, Restriction Endonuclease Digestion, Gibson Assembly, Golden Gate Assembly, bacterial transformations, and plasmid purifications.
- Support high-throughput protein purification workflows to enable rapid screening and characterization of constructs.
- Maintain detailed records of experimental procedures and results in electronic lab notebooks.
- Collaborate with team members to support cloning and construct generation for protein expression.
- Assist in troubleshooting and optimizing molecular workflows to improve efficiency and throughput.
- Manage multiple tasks and projects sim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
- Maintain lab organization and inventory of reagents and supplies.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Molecular Biology, Biochemistry, or a related field.
- Minimum of 2 years of post-graduation, hands-on laboratory experience in molecular biology techniques. Title level (RA or SRA) will be determined based on education and total years of relevant experience.
- Experience with protein purification or antibody-related workflows is a plus.
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team.
- Comfortable working in a dynamic environment with shifting priorities.
